Pendant ses vacances au Chili, Alicia, une jeune américaine réservée, se retrouve embarquée par sa cousine Sara et sa bande d'amis sur une île isolée. Personne ne fait vraiment d'effort pour intégrer Alicia. Elle se replie de plus en plus sur elle-même et commence à perdre peu à peu ses facultés mentales. Ses amis n'y prennent pas garde, est peut-être déjà trop tard?
